The middle U.S. hospital bills $113,979 for Skin Graft Except for Skin Ulcer or Cellulitis with Complications. The dearest hospitals charge about 3.9x what the cheapest do for the same coded work. Medicare actually paid about $28,722 per case.
These are charges, not quotes. What you pay depends on your insurance and your own case. The figures matter because the charge is where an uninsured or out-of-network bill starts.

Questions people ask
What do U.S. hospitals charge for Skin Graft Except for Skin Ulcer or Cellulitis with Complications?
Across 13 U.S. hospitals, the middle charge for Skin Graft Except for Skin Ulcer or Cellulitis with Complications is $113,979. Half of hospitals charge less than that and half charge more. The cheapest quarter charge under $93,790 and the dearest quarter over $211,602.
Why do hospitals charge such different amounts for the same procedure?
Because a hospital charge is a list price it sets itself, not a regulated rate. For Skin Graft Except for Skin Ulcer or Cellulitis with Complications, the hospitals in the dearest tenth charge about 3.9x what the cheapest tenth charge for the same coded work. Insurers negotiate their own rates from those lists, which is why the charge and what is actually paid can be very far apart.
Is that what I would actually pay?
No. $28,722 is roughly what Medicare actually paid per case, against an average charge of $153,496. If you have insurance, your plan pays a negotiated rate and you pay your deductible and coinsurance. If you are uninsured or out of network, the hospital's charge is where your bill starts — which is why the gap matters. Ask for a written good-faith estimate before treatment.
What this code covers
CMS records this work as MS-DRG 577: “SKIN GRAFT EXCEPT FOR SKIN ULCER OR CELLULITIS WITH CC”. A DRG covers a whole inpatient stay rather than a single item, so the charge includes the room, the procedure and the care around it. Codes that mention complications carry a different, usually higher price.
